Solution for 3(n+2)=7-4n equation:


Simplifying
3(n + 2) = 7 + -4n

Reorder the terms:
3(2 + n) = 7 + -4n
(2 * 3 + n * 3) = 7 + -4n
(6 + 3n) = 7 + -4n

Solving
6 + 3n = 7 + -4n

Solving for variable 'n'.

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'4n' to each side of the equation.
6 + 3n + 4n = 7 + -4n + 4n

Combine like terms: 3n + 4n = 7n
6 + 7n = 7 + -4n + 4n

Combine like terms: -4n + 4n = 0
6 + 7n = 7 + 0
6 + 7n = 7

Add '-6' to each side of the equation.
6 + -6 + 7n = 7 + -6

Combine like terms: 6 + -6 = 0
0 + 7n = 7 + -6
7n = 7 + -6

Combine like terms: 7 + -6 = 1
7n = 1

Divide each side by '7'.
n = 0.1428571429

Simplifying
n = 0.1428571429
